W258 PHU is a 2000 Mitsubishi Carisma in Silver with a 1,834c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 11 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 63.6%.
Across all 2000 Mitsubishi Carisma models, the average MOT pass rate is 67.3% with a typical mileage of 78,477 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Mitsubishi Carisma f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 27,459 recorded failures. If you're considering buying W258 PHU,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Mitsubishi Carisma typically stays on UK roads for around 30 years. At 26 years old, this Mitsubishi Carisma is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
